Team Effort as Fauquier Wins its 13th District Championship
by: Ted Proctor - 02-6-2018

Team Effort as Fauquier Wins its 13th District Championship

On Saturday February 3rd the Fauquier wrestling team participated in the 2018 Northwestern District Wrestling Championship and came home with the first-place trophy for the 13th time in school history.

Not too sure if there are any other Fauquier County High School athletic sports programs that have won a District Championship 13 times, but after taking second place to Liberty HS last season (2017) Fauquier needed points from every wrestler to achieve and become the 2018 District Championships.

A similar path from a season ago had Liberty on top of the leader board through all five of the District wrestling rounds on Saturday. But halfway through the 2018 Championship Finals after Fauquier 145lbs Joe Del Gallo won a 7-5 decision over Ricky Ryan (Liberty), team Fauquier finally leaped over the Eagles to take the lead.

Home Dual - Senior Recognition Night
by: Ted Proctor - 01-27-2018

Jan., 26th 2018
Home Dual - Senior Recognition Night
Home Fauquier HS

Warrenton, VA: On Jan. 26th the #9 Fauquier Wrestling team hosted a home dual meet with #1 VAWA ranked Battlefield High School. A match between two top Virginia wrestling programs having a total of 15 seniors and 10 ranked wrestlers in the state competing to see who can earn more bonus points, in this classic Friday night dual. A Senior Night for the Falcons as they could not hold off the Bobcats as team Fauquier fell 20-47. Fauquier went 6-7 with victories coming from (113) Alex Bautista, (132+ Kyle Budd, (145) Joe De Gallo, (182_ Sam Fisher, (195) Franco Camarca and (285) Tyler Raymond.   Match Results > >

Fauquier Wrestler of the Week (Jan. 22)
by: Ted Proctor - 1-22-2018

Fauquier Wrestler of the Week (Jan. 22)

Congratulations to Senior Franco Camarca for going 4-0 last weekend at the Ultimate Challenge and becoming an Ultimate Challenge Champion. Franco had two pins and scored 34 team points while beating two top 4 VAWA ranked wrestlers. Franco Camarca won 3-2 over #1 ranked Paul Pierce (Brooke Point) in the early rounds, and in the Championship Final round Franco Camarca scored a late third period takedown to win 3-1 over #4 ranked and returning 6A State Champ Tyler Matheny (Lake Braddock).

Budd wins the 2017 Mount Mat Madness
by: Ted Proctor - 12-30-2017

Dec. 29th and 30th 2017
Budd wins the 2017 Mount Mat Madness
Mount Saint Joseph High School, MD

Mount Saint Joseph HS. Baltimore MD: The Falcons ended with five wrestlers that placed and finishes in 7th place with 110pts at the Mount Mat Madness XIV. A two day Holiday wrestling tournament where teams from Maryland, Delaware, and Virginia were paired into individual 32 man-brackets. Congratulations goes to 132lbs Kyle Budd for winning the 2017 MMM XIV. Budd went 5-0 with three falls and a 6-4 win over Connor Strong of Mt St Joseph in the finals.

Other Fauquier notables were 182lbs Sam Fisher who went 3-1 and took 2nd place; 220lbs Tyler Raymond who took 3rd place, and 145lbs Joe Del Gallo finishing in 5th place. The complete updates on team Fauquier can be found here:   MMM XIV > >

2017 VHSL New Alignment for all Virginia Public Schools
by: Ted Proctor - 6-14-2017

2017 VHSL New Alignment for all Virginia Public Schools

As the 2016-17 school year ends the Virginia High School League (VHSL) has been busy realigning all public high schools into new Regions and Districts for the start of the 2017-18 school year.

Based on student population and enrollment, the VHSL, whom is the governing body that regulates all the public high schools in the Commonwealth of Virginia, has gone public with these new alignments. They will stay intact for two consecutive years.   Read more here > >
